Mid90sWe continue trudging into the new year with another slow week that features only a couple of new films debuting on home video and an equal number of significant releases getting the 4K Ultra HD treatment. But there's still plenty of hi-def goodness to be had as Kino Lorber is releasing a couple of horror/thriller classic titles on blu-ray: Lee Katzin's What Ever Happened to Aunt Alice is getting a brand new 4K remaster from the original camera negatives as is the Barbara Stanwyck made-for-television thriller The House That Would Not Die which is getting a shiny new 2K remaster.

Shout Factory gets in the game this week with a 30th Anniversary Edition blu-ray release of Rob Reiner's classic comedy When Harry Met Sally that stars Billy Crystal and Meg Ryan. The package features a brand new 4K restoration of the film from original camera negatives in addition to a new interview with Rob Reiner and Billy Crystal.

The company is also putting out Joel Schumacher's "snuff" thriller 8MM on blu-ray. The film stars Nicolas Cage, Joaquin Phoenix, James Gandolfini and Catherine Keener. It will feature a new interview with producer/director Joel Schumacher. {googleads}

A couple of titles getting the 4K UltraHD treatment are Castle Rock: The Complete First Season and the Gregory Plotkin-directed slasher film, Hell Fest from Lionsgate that features a Dolby Vision HDR presentation of the film in addition to a making-of featurette.

The American blaxploitation film Willie Dynamite is getting a blu-ray release this week as is the 1993 classic thriller Judgment Night that stars Emilio Estevez, Cuba Gooding, Jr., and Jeremy Piven Whishaw will feature a brand new remaster of the film. And of course there's that fantastic soundtrack!

MVD Rewind is releasing a two-disc Collector's Edition of the 1992 sci-fi-action classic Nemesis that contains a two-disc set with tons of interviews, extras, and commentaries as well as a director's cut of the film AND the longer Japanese cut.

And finally, Lionsgate is hitting us up with a little title that went largely overlooked when it came out a few months ago but deserves a much more respect and attention. Jonah Hill's love letter to the skating culture that formed his youth, Mid90s is coming out on blu-ray and represents our Most Wanted on Blu-ray for the week of January 8, 2019.

A psychological-horror series set in the Stephen King multiverse, the series combines the mythological scale and intimate character storytelling of King’s best-loved works, weaving an epic saga of darkness and light, played out on a few square miles of Maine woodland. The fictional Maine town of Castle Rock has figured prominently in King’s literary career: CujoThe Dark HalfIT and Needful Things, as well as novella The Body and numerous short stories such as Rita Hayworth and The Shawshank Redemption are either set there or contain references to Castle Rock. Castle Rock is an original suspense/thriller — a first-of-its-kind reimagining that explores the themes and worlds uniting the entire King canon, while brushing up against some of his most iconic and beloved stories.

Ruth Bennett (Barbara Stanwyck, Witness to Murder, The Lady Eve) has inherited an old house in Gettysburg, Pennsylvania Amish country. She moves into the house with her niece, Sara Dunning (Kitty Winn, The Panic in Needle Park, The Exorcist). The house was built before the Revolutionary War and is said to be haunted by the spirits of its original inhabitants. With the help of Pat McDougal (Richard Egan, The 300 Spartans, GOG), a local professor, and one of his students, Stan Whitman (Michael Anderson Jr., The Sons of Katie Elder, Major Dundee), they delve into the history of the house and find a scandal that involves a Revolutionary War general, who was suspected of being a traitor, and his daughter, who had disappeared after eloping with her boyfriend, a young British soldier. The spirits of the general and his daughter take possession of Pat's and Sara's bodies and a dark secret is revealed.
